Untreated,
high blood pressure known as hypertension, can cause damage
to the kidney, eyes, blood vessels and the heart. The scary thing is
that the damage done to your body is irreversible.
The great news is that it
is very easy to find out if you have high blood pressure. Most pharmacies
have a self-monitor station for checking your blood pressure. Get
readings several times over a week to get an average. Then discuss these results with your doctor or pharmacist.

Below is a list of the top herbs, vitamins and supplements
that are
known to lower blood pressure.
#1 Coenzyme Q10 (CoQ10)
This
vitamin-like chemical is found in every part of your body. Clinical
studies show that taking 100 mg twice daily can bring the blood pressure
down. This natural substance is also essential for the health of your heart as well.
#2 Fish Oil
Typically,
elevated blood pressure is commonly associated with heart disease. Fish
oil contains large amount of omega-3 fatty acids known to protect
against heart disease. It also lowers blood pressure modestly. Take
fish oil for heart health and it's ability to lower blood pressure as a
bonus!
#3 Garlic
As
with fish oil, high intake of garlic lowers the risk of heart disease.
Several studies show that garlic can effectively lower blood pressure
by up to 7%. This is a significant effect so everyone suffering from
hypertension need to take this herb.
#4 Calcium and Magnesium
These two
essential minerals are used to build strong bones but they do much more
than that. Calcium and magnesium
are needed by the blood vessels to control blood pressure.
#5 Vitamin C
This
essential vitamin is very well known for curing the common cold, but
did you know that it is a potent antioxidant that can also lower blood
pressure as well?
#6 Potassium
A
lot of research studies show that high dose of potassium lowers blood
pressure. However, a word of caution here. The dosage needed to lower
blood pressure is very high and should only be taken under the
supervision of a doctor.
Don’t forget to make lifestyle changes
like managing stress, increasing physical activity and eating more
fruits and vegetables. Cutting back on salt intake is scientifically
proven beyond any doubt to lower blood pressure. Check the article on DASH
